The Christ's Church Academy Eagles will head out to square off against the Paxon School For Advanced Studies Golden Eagles at 6:30 p.m. on Thursday. Christ's Church Academy will aim to continue their three-game streak of scoring more runs each contest than the last.
Christ's Church Academy lost a heartbreaker the last time they played Madison County, but it's fair to say they got their revenge given the result of Tuesday's matchup. The Eagles blew past the Cowboys 8-1 on Tuesday. The result was nothing new for the Eagles, who have now won seven games by seven runs or more so far this season.
Josh Stembridge looked comfortable as he tossed three innings while giving up just one earned run off one hit. He has been consistent : he hasn't given up more than two hits in five consecutive appearances.

On the hitting side, Jackson Vennard and Shawn Robinson did most of the damage at the plate: Vennard scored a run while going 2-for-3, while Robinson scored two runs and stole a base while getting on base in three of his four plate appearances. Robinson has become a key player for Christ's Church Academy: the team is 6-1 when he posts at least two runs, but 7-8 otherwise.
Meanwhile, Paxon School For Advanced Studies was not able to break out of their rough patch on Tuesday as the team picked up their fourth straight defeat. They fell 5-2 to Mandarin.
Paxon School For Advanced Studies saw six different players step up and record at least one hit. One of them was Robert Bryson, who went 2-for-4 with one triple and one run.
Christ's Church Academy pushed their record up to 13-9 with the win, which was their third straight at home. The home victories came thanks in part to their pitching effort, having only surrendered 2.7 runs on average over those games. As for Paxon School For Advanced Studies, their loss dropped their record down to 13-7.
The pitchers for both teams better look sharp on Thursday as neither team is afraid to steal. Christ's Church Academy has been swiping bases left and right this season, having averaged 3.1 stolen bases per game. However, it's not like Paxon School For Advanced Studies struggles in that department as they've been averaging an even more impressive 6.8 stolen bases. The only question left is which team can snag more.
Christ's Church Academy skirted past Paxon School For Advanced Studies 4-3 when the teams last played back in April of 2024. The rematch might be a little tougher for the Eagles since the team won't have the home-field advantage this time around. We'll see if the change in venue makes a difference.
